@champybabyI was butchered by two bad ‘punch graft’ hair transplants at 18. There werre two rows of scars. The top donor scar was excised leaving it looking like a strip scar. But the top of my hairline was/is the big problem. I had rows of ‘doll hair’ that was excised over several procedures over a few years. It has left me with a strip like scar running along my hairline. I have had SMP over this as well. It has brought my hairline lower than it should be but it’s better than the scarring that was left.

That was actually the plan by removing the top scar with a strip. We were then going to try and take the lower scar out and then possibly take out the two leaving just one strip scar. To be honest I should have left the donor scars as they were from the botched hair transplants. Irregular scars hide easier and strip scars catch the eye. Plus I want to keep as many grafts as possible for Eugenix. 
Yes at 18 you identify with your hair so much. That’s why I try very hard to persuade young people from making the same mistake that I did.
